The Department of Economics at Wayne State University is actively engaged in teaching, research, and community service related to how economics drives the world. We offer degree programs in undergraduate and graduate studies, including post-graduate certificates.

Our primary mission is to provide both undergraduate and graduate students with a rigorous, broad, and critical program in theoretical and empirical economics.

Our faculty are engaged in a variety of research topics, which include:

  • Analysis of trucking and transportation
  • Economic analysis of the effect of health care policy on the cost of care and health outcomes
  • Analysis of pricing strategies of firms
  • Effects of economic growth on income inequality
  • Predicting what kinds of events will affect oil prices
